About this episode
Most people like to blame others for their bad luck and misfortune. It feels good, however, what they don’t know is that they lose all their power to change. So if you’ve ever caught yourself blaming others and you just want to know how to get your life back together, listen now as Dan breaks down his 3 most important life rules.
